Industrial Applications: Water Treatment & Oil Well Drilling
This White Powder Flocculant is engineered for two primary industrial sectors. In water treatment, it acts as a high-efficiency coagulant aid, accelerating the settling of suspended solids in municipal wastewater and industrial effluent processing. In oil well drilling, it functions as a viscosity modifier and fluid loss control agent, enhancing borehole stability and drilling efficiency. Storage & Handling
- Store in a cool, dry, well-ventilated area, sealed and away from direct sunlight.
- Keep away from incompatible materials, food and feed sources.
- Handle with appropriate personal protective equipment (gloves, goggles, lab coat).
- Follow good industrial hygiene practices. Avoid inhalation and skin contact.
- Refer to MSDS for detailed storage and safety instructions.
